> I would like to propose a formation of "Organization of African Computer
> Professionals (OACP)." Please note that the name is in quotes meaning that
> it can be called whatever we decide upon. This organization will be for
> Information Technology professionals and individuals with great interest in
> the field to promote new computer technology awareness to our people - both
> here and back home. I had been thinking about this for a while and after
> talking to Mensah Lassey yesterday, I was encouraged to put it out in the
> open. So if you are interested, contact either me or Mensah at
> [log in to unmask] or [log in to unmask] respectively. Based on the type of
> response that we receive, contacts will be made to set up a place and time
> where we can have our first meeting. Please forward this to anyone you know
> that may be interested but may not be on the AAM email list. Thanks to all
> of you and have a pleasant day.
